In Gwinnett, the sales tax is 6%. You buy a watch that costs $45.50. What is the TOTAL cost including tax?.

Answer: $48.23

Step-by-step explanation: %6 is equal to 0.06 so you can multiply the price of the watch by 1.06 because that is the base price plus the sales tax. That gets you $48.23
